NEW PLATFORMS

We’ve just doubled the number of platforms Cloud Build supports! In addition to iOS, Android, and Webplayer we’ve now added Windows desktop, Mac OS X, and Linux! There are 32-bit / 64-bit / Universal options for OS X and Linux, and 32-bit / 64-bit versions for Windows.

EASIER, MORE FLEXIBLE BUILD CONFIGURATIONS

Prior to this update, if you wanted to build a project for several different ways for the same platform, you’d have to replicate your project in our system multiple times (for example a Google Play Android version, and another Android version for a different store). No more! This update allows for any number of ‘build targets’ inside a single project - and each target can build from a different branch and have different signing credentials.

 You’ll find this feature in the Targets section for a project.

In existing projects, your current platforms will be named ‘default-PLATFORM’ but as you add new targets you’ll notice you can name them anything you want: who it’s for, which branch its building from, etc.

SPLIT BINARY (.APK + .OBB) SUPPORT FOR ANDROID

By far the most popular request on our feedback category was the ability for users to create split binary files for Android builds. We’re really excited to be able to give this to you - check in the Advanced Settings area of any Android target

ALL FEATURES AVAILABLE IN ALL PLANS

Finally, we’ve heard you loud and clear: Cloud Build is most useful when you have access to all it’s powerful features. Starting today, users in all plans are able to access the following features:

  • Pre- and Post-Export Methods
  • Git, SVN, Mercurial, and Perforce integration
  • Custom Scripting Defines
  • Custom Scene Lists
  • Development / Debug builds
  • Unlimited Collaborators per project
